I'm having a rough time, folks, and I'm looking for some help!

Last weekend, my youngest son and I got the stomach flu. Because of nausea and diarrhea, I didn't eat for three days. I had a couple of decent days mid-week where I could eat a little food, but everything still makes me sick to my stomach. This past Thursday night, my diarrhea returned. Friday, I tried to eat very light, but everything I put in my stomach made me nauseous. Same for yesterday.

Today, I had a few sips of my berry smoothie and couldn't handle any more. I waited a few hours, and tried to have a little avocado with some quinoa tabouli I made, but only got past a few bites. Now, I'm trying to eat a banana, but it tastes so sweet it's hard to eat. I'm sort of hungry, but it's like the flavors are too intense for me to handle. I'm going to try to take some more probiotics and see if that helps.

I've already dropped 3 1/2 pounds this week from not being able to eat. My husband is now bugging me to abandon this "diet" and have some "real food." Frankly, I can't figure out why I haven't bounced back from this flu. I'm starting to get concerned that I've picked up something really weird, like a parasite or something.

Has anyone else experienced this? I'm wondering if I should do some type of cleanse or juice fast since food is nauseating to me right now.

I'd really appreciate some help... if I don't feel better by Monday, I guess I'll have to go in to the doctor, but I was hoping to get better on my own.

Thanks in advance for any help you can give me... I'm really frustrated at this point! :confused:
